SuldyukarNefteGaz (part of the RNG Group of Companies) donated filters for water treatment plant in Suldyukar, which was most affected by water pollution in Irelyakh and Viluy rivers in Mirny district.
As soon as it became known about the plight in which the residents of Suldyukar were found, the SuldyukarNefteGaz management contacted the authorities of Myrny district and the village. It turned out that bottled drinking water had already been delivered to Suldyukar. But since it would be sufficient only for the first time, it was decided to take drastic measures and purchase the necessary equipment for the local water treatment plant.
The filters were delivered on September 28 by cargo aircraft IL-76 of the Alrosa airline from the Moscow airport Zhukovsky. For the water treatment plant, self-cleaning filters with programmable electronic systems were purchased. According to the experience of SuldyukarNefteGaz specialists, even with very polluted water, the life of these filters is 3 years.
Recall, the pollution of rivers in the Republic of Sakha (Yakutia) occurred on August 17. After the torrential rains at the dredging site of the Myrninsky Mining and Benefication Complex, dams broke through, because of this, a large amount of contaminated industrial water got into the rivers Irelyakh, Malaya Botuobuya, and then to Viluy. The first consequences of the disaster were felt by the inhabitants of Suldyukar, which is located 30 km from the mouth of Malaya Botuobuya. There are 200 people living in the village.
